Luka Doncic Sidelined for Personal Reasons as Lakers Kick Off Road Trip
The Los Angeles Lakers face a challenging situation as they prepare for a vital three-game road trip. They will be without their star player, Luka Dončić, who is sidelined for personal reasons. Coach JJ Redick confirmed his absence and expressed hope for a quick return, but no specific date has been provided.
Luka Dončić’s Impact and Absence
Dončić’s absence is significant for the Lakers, who currently hold a record of 15-5, placing them second in the Western Conference. The team initiated their trip on Thursday, December 4, and it will extend until December 7. They will play against the Toronto Raptors, Boston Celtics, and Philadelphia 76ers during this stretch.

Dončić’s Season Performance
At just 26 years old, Luka Dončić has been a standout player this season. He leads the league in scoring, averaging an impressive 35.3 points per game. In addition, he contributes significantly to the team’s overall performance with an average of 8.9 rebounds and 8.9 assists.
In his last game, which took place on December 1 against the Phoenix Suns, Dončić scored 38 points, alongside 11 rebounds and 5 assists. However, that effort ended in a 125-108 defeat for the Lakers. His exceptional skills have made him a key player, and his absence will undoubtedly challenge the team as they aim for victory during their road trip.
